Last Minute Halloween Costumes That Won't Break The Bank
Why spend $100 dollars this year on buying a costume when you can make one yourself for half the cost? Good question! Here are some DIY alternatives that won't break the bank.
-
1. Mummy
How To Make It: White clothes + old white bed sheet you don’t mind tearing into strips + white gauze bandages = The best $10 costume at the party.
-
2. Bunch Of Grapes
How To Make It: Green or purple clothes + matching balloons + a few safety pins= Coolest fruit at the party.
-
3. Static Cling
How To Make It: Black or white clothes + random clothes (socks, briefs, tees) and dryer sheets + safety pins = Static Magic.
-
4. Old Lady
How To Make It: Old fashioned dress + rolled-down knee-high nylons + large black frame purse + an ugly necklace = You've just become your grandma.
-
5. Nerd
How To Make It: Button down shirt + high waist pants + glasses + textbooks = Ultimate nerd.
-
6. Jelly Beans
How To Make It: Clear plastic bag + multi-colored balloons to slip underneath = The sweetest candy of them all.
-
7. Ghost
How To Make It: White sheet (plus cutouts for your eyes) = Easiest costume ever.
-
8. Baby
How To Make It: PJs + pacifier +teddy bear = (Even cheaper if you have a younger sibling.)
-
9. Road Trip
How To Make It: Sweatsuit + white or yellow masking tape (for street lines) + toy cars + safety pins = Ultimate Road Trip.
-
10. Where’s Waldo
How To Make It: Red and white striped tee + beanie + eye glasses + jeans= A cost efficient way to Waldobomb your friends.
